Every year 1,000 volunteers join forces for the
Great American River Clean Up. The volunteers
include cyclists, scuba divers, equestrians,
anglers, runners, and paddlers. Local businesses,
schools and service organizations also come out
and volunteer for this event.

Covering a span of 17 sites along the parkway,
volunteers collect 20 tons of trash from the Parkway
and river bottom every year!

Participation in the Great American River Clean Up
is a real contribution to the health of the Parkway
and river. Removing trash and debris prevents
pollutants from entering the watershed,
harming the wildlife, or creating hazards
for recreational users. Additionally,
keeping the Parkway clean protects
ocean life by preventing trash from
being washed downstream during
the winter rains.

The Great American River Clean Up
is held in conjunction with the Coastal
Cleanup Day sponsored by the
California Coastal Commission. This
annual cleanup is held throughout
California along bays, creeks, lakes
rivers, highways, and the coast.
